Key Responsibilities

  • Prospecting and identifying dealer growth opportunities within an assigned geography.
  • Delivering growth through the activation of dormant and/or under penetrated accounts.
  • Identifying products or services that best meet the customer's stated/identified needs.
  • Using business intelligence and market expertise to propose product screens and product segment recommendations.
  • Traveling throughout the geographic area of the assigned territory.
  • Traveling to the Solution Center or other Distribution Centers as determined by Management.
  • Growing program dealers in the assigned geography while improving total units through program as a % of total units sold.
  • Developing and growing opportunity accounts graduating them to the Key Account Manager.
  • Ensuring quality CRM data to enable customer retention, business development, follow-up actions, and other sales activities.
  • Working collaboratively with all support roles to drive additional unit/revenue opportunities in assigned geography to build strong customer relationships that drive a positive customer experience.
  • Utilizing data, analytics, and standardized reporting to improve time management and drive strategic activity.
  • Attending local or regional trade events to enhance market visibility.
